Peggy was standing in Grace's tent while the inventor frantically dug through her suitcase. She had received a frantic note from her friend and found her pacing the length of her tent, avoiding her large inventions.

"Yes!" Grace exclaimed, still digging through her clothes, which didn't have many options given that she never thought she would be going on a date at an Army base. "And I have nothing to wear!"

Peggy frowned before walking over to her nervous friend. "First of all, Gracie, you need to take a deep breath. Worrying will do you no good, darling. Secondly, of course you do. What about that red dress that you wore a few weeks ago? A little birdie told me Steve couldn't keep his eyes off you."

Grace pursed her lips before shrugging. "I do like that dress..."

Her friend smiled softly before pulling the dress out of the makeshift closet beside her bed and holding it up to the inventor. "It will be perfect. I'll lend you my red lipstick, you have heels. He's going to swoon."

"Does it seem strange that we're getting dinner?" Grace asked, fidgeting with her fingers. "I mean, we have jobs to do."

"No one ever said you couldn't have a little fun," Peggy replied with a wave of her hand. "Gracie, we're in the middle of a war. It's important to do something other than make bloody good weapons for the army."

Grace chuckled and nodded. "Okay. It's just..." She let out a breath. "What do you do after dinner?"

"Have you not gone out to a dinner with a man before?" Peggy asked, tilting her head. Grace shook her head. "Why?"

"Because when I was nineteen, Howard practically locked me in the house when he found out about it," she replied, fidgeting with the scarf around her neck. "I haven't told him about this."

Peggy nodded. "Smart." She smiled at her best friend. "Nothing horrible happens. You just get to know the other person and have fun."

"You promise?"

"You already get along with him," she said, shrugging. "You'll be just fine, Gracie. Now, let's get you dressed. I feel like a proud mother."

"I'm older."

"But I've gone on a date before."

𝐁𝐔𝐂𝐊𝐘 𝐇𝐄𝐋𝐃 𝐇𝐈𝐒 𝐇𝐄𝐀𝐃 in his hand and watched his blonde friend pace in front of his bed. "This is ridiculous," he said, annoyed. "Why are you panicking? She's already said yes to dinner. It's not like you're asking her to marry you."

"Bucky, I don't do this very often!" Steve exclaimed.

"What, date?" Steve glared at him and the brunette held up his hands. "Sorry. Look, it's not that complicated. You take her out for a nice dinner, you pay for that nice dinner, you walk her home, and if you're feeling bold enough, you kiss her goodnight."

"Kiss her?" Steve repeated, anxiously. "Oh, this was a bad idea."

"Steve, you're not the little guy from Brooklyn anymore," Bucky told him, letting out a breath. "If you're worried about her not liking you because you're smaller than her, that's not gonna happen. Besides, she talked to you at the Expo."

"She was just being nice," he contradicted and the brunette on the bed rolled his eyes.

"And how do you know that?" he asked, becoming increasingly more annoyed by his friend's lack of confidence. "Maybe she was actually interested in listening to you. Despite what you thought, Steve, you were a good person when you were small. And still are."

"Buck—"

"For crying out loud, Steve, go to her tent and take her to dinner!" Bucky exclaimed with a groan. "And let me read the Hobbit in peace. And don't forget to be a gentleman! And give her your jacket if she gets cold!"

Steve let out a breath before nodding and leaving. Bucky shook his head as his friend disappeared from view.

"I deserve an award for this..." he muttered before returning to his book.

"𝐎𝐇, 𝐘𝐎𝐔 𝐋𝐎𝐎𝐊 𝐁𝐄𝐀𝐔𝐓𝐈𝐅𝐔𝐋!" Peggy exclaimed, clasping her hands and smiling at her friend. Grace was standing in front of the mirror she had in her tent, smoothing out the dress she was in. "Steve is going to be absolutely speechless!"

"You think?"

She nodded. "Of course he will! Red truly is your color. And when the two of you get married, be sure to thank Sergeant Barnes and me for getting the two of you off the base."

Grace frowned. "We're not getting married, Peg. It's only dinner."

"You say now..." Peggy smirked before leaving the tent. Grace shook her head at her friend before glancing at her watch.

"Wow..." She looked up and saw Steve standing at the entrance of her tent. "You, uh... you look beautiful."

A blush spread across her cheeks and she looked down. "Thank you. So do you. Nice uniform."

"Yeah, I, uh..." He cleared his throat. "I don't have anything else to wear."

Grace smiled. "I don't mind. It brings out your eyes. Besides, you earned those honors." She bit her lip and Steve glanced behind them.

"Shall we?"

She nodded and quickly grabbed her clutch before following him out of the tent. They walked in awkward silence for a while before Grace cleared her throat.

"Are you ready for your upcoming fight against Hydra?" she asked him, looking over at the blonde beside her. "I think I have four chests full of weapons ready for you. And many more coming."

"Already?" he asked with a chuckle. "That's impressive. I think we're as ready as we'll ever be."

"And your friend?" Steve looked over at her. "Is he ready after everything that happened to him?"

"I think so."

"Good." Grace looked down when she noticed a paper fall from Steve's coat. "I think you... dropped this..."

Steve glanced behind him and scratched the back of his neck. "Oh, um..."

Grace looked up with a small smile. "Is this me?" she asked, looking back at the drawing she was holding in her hands.

"Well..."

"It's really good," she said, admiring the artwork. "Are my eyes really that sparkly?" She turned back to look at him and smiled. "You know, if the Army doesn't work out, you may have a future as an artist."

Steve chuckled. "Well, I don't know about that, but yes, your eyes are that sparkly. Especially when you're talking about your inventions. Your eyes also crinkle at the ends whenever you're especially happy."

"If I didn't know you, that might sound incredibly creepy that you noticed all of that," Grace told him, smiling at his words. She went to return the drawing to him but he shook his head.

"Keep it," he said and she tilted her head. "It just means that I have to draw another one."

Grace pursed her lips before carefully sliding the drawing into her clutch. "I never saw you as one who had that much confidence with women, Captain," she replied, both of them walking in step with the other.

He huffed out a laugh. "Oh, believe me, I do not. Women always tended to look the other way whenever they saw me."

"Why?"

"Well, I was just too small," he said with a shrug and she frowned. "Most women don't really want to be out with someone they could have stepped on."

"That seems a bit unfair," she replied, shaking her head. "You're still the same person you were only a few months ago." She looked up. "Only taller."

"Then you are the first to say that," he said, smiling. "Aside from Bucky, though you don't yell at me."

Grace chuckled. "Have you known him long?" she asked before shrugging. "The way you talk about him... I can tell how much you love him."

He nodded. "We were twelve," he answered, smiling at the memory. "There were a couple of big kids who were beating me up and, in his words, he was the savior that I so desperately needed." He laughed and shrugged. "I suppose that's true."

The brunette smiled. "Where exactly are we going?" she asked, glancing at the man beside her. "Not that I don't enjoy walking, but..."

"Just up here," he replied, gesturing in front of them. She followed his extended arm and found a picnic blanket with a basket on top. "It's a nice night," he said. "I hope you don't mind a picnic."

"I love picnics."

𝐆𝐑𝐀𝐂𝐄 𝐋𝐎𝐎𝐊𝐄𝐃 𝐔𝐏 𝐀𝐓 the sky, pointing out different constellations to Steve while he smiled softly at the way her eyes lit up in excitement.

"There's Ursa Major," she said before looking next to it. "And Leo and Leo Minor."

"When did you become so good at astronomy?" he asked and she looked over at him with a shrug.

"Everybody needs a hobby," she replied with a smile. "Besides, the stars are fascinating. There's a whole other world up there."

"Do you really believe that?"

She nodded. "Of course I do. Haven't you ever read Norse Mythology?" she asked, leaning on her back to get a better look at the sky. "Asgard is one of the Nine Worlds of Norse Mythology and it's located in the sky."

"Really?"

"Yeah. Besides, there's something intriguing about the possibility of another world in the sky. And when I was living with my father, it was one of the few things that I had a book on that I became determined to know every constellation in the sky."

He smiled. "Did you?"

"I got up to sixty," she said, shaking her head. "After that, I had other things to keep me entertained."

Steve nodded. "We should probably go."

"Of course," she replied with a smile. "You have an evil organization to take down."

"But, uh, I've really enjoyed this," he said and a faint blush spread across her cheeks. "Maybe you could teach me more about constellations."

"Oh, you think there's going to be a next time?" She walked closer and smiled. "Well, you have to ask Captain Rogers."

His lips formed a tight line. "Would you care to go out again, Miss Stark?"

Grace shrugged. "Ask me again when you come back from your mission," she said before kissing his cheek. "Meet me at my tent tomorrow for a rundown on the weapons. I'll see you then, Captain."
